Domingo Vio

3×3 · top 19.5% of 284,439 all-time · competing since February 2015 · 2015VIOD01

Domingo Vio has been competing for 12 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 13.57, set at Instituto Nacional Open 2016, puts him in the top 19.5%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 383rd in Chile. Across 7 competitions since February 2015, he has put 139 official solves on the record across six events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 12% around a typical one, steadier than 68%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ds. His 3×3 best has come down from 22.46 in February 2015 to 13.57, a 40% improvement. Domingo has entered seven competitions, more competitions than 88% of everyone who has ever competed.
